  • Graduate of an accredited school of radiologic technology (required) or
  • Associate Degree (preferred)
  • 1 year radiologic technologist experience without ARRTCT (required) or
  • No experience with ARRTCT (required)
  • ARRT American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(R) (required) and
  • ARRT American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(CT) (required) or
  • ARRT American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(CT) (if 1 year radiology technician exp) within 12 Months (required) and
  • CMRT Certified Medical Radiologic Technologist Either by the TDH or TMB (required) and
  • BCLS Basic Cardiac Life Support prior to providing independent patient care (required)

Position ResponsibilitiesA Texas HealthCT Technologistis responsible for explaining procedures to patient or guardian/family member if applicable prior to and during exam imaging correct anatomical area of interest and pathology according to department protocols and performing complex procedures including age related criteria and developmental considerations.

In addition to the required qualifications a successfulCTTechnologistwill

  • process and manipulate images analyze image quality troubleshoot make technique adjustments or repeat procedures as needed.
  • correctly send and transfer images to PACS.
  • assess and recognize the patients emotional physical developmental cognitive and psychosocial conditions.
  • operate care for and maintain equipment.
  • prepare room for examination (i.e. suction oxygen supplies).
  • administer contrast media and other medications in accordance with medication administration guidelines.
  • maintain equipment and room to sanitary standards between patients (injectors table tops floors).
